Gross combustion values for some common materials can be found in the table below:
| Material | Gross Combustion Value (Btu/lb) |
|
| Carbon | C | 14,093 |
| Hydrogen | H2 | 61,095 |
| Carbon Monoxide | CO | 4,347 |
| Methane | CH4 | 23,875 |
| Ethane | C2H4 | 22,323 |
| Propane | C3H8 | 21,669 |
| n-Butane | C4H10 | 21,321 |
| Isobutane | C4H10 | 21,271 |
| n-Pentane | C5H12 | 21,095 |
| Isopentane | C5H12 | 21,047 |
| Neopentane | C5H12 | 20,978 |
| n-Hexane | C6H14 | 20,966 |
| Ethylene | C2H4 | 21,636 |
| Propylene | C3H6 | 21,048 |
| n-Butene | C4H8 | 20,854 |
| Isobutene | C4H8 | 20,737 |
| n-Pentene | C5H10 | 20,720 |
| Benzene | C6H6 | 18,184 |
| Toluene | C7H8 | 18,501 |
| Xylene | C8H10 | 18,651 |
| Acetylene | C2H2 | 21,502 |
| Naphthalene | C10H8 | 17,303 |
| Methyl alcohol | CH3OH | 10,258 |
| Ethyl alcohol | C2H5OH | 13,161 |
| Ammonia | NH3 | 9,667 |
